    摘要:

    本文旨在探讨井地结合测井技术在地下水环境数据监测中的应用,以实现对地下水资源的有效保护和可持续利用。研究采用井地结合测井技术,在地下水监测井中进行实地应用,通过测量具有代表性的地下水监测井,结合地质背景资料和数据分析,对地下水环境进行全面、系统的监测。经过实地应用,井地结合测井技术能够准确获取地下水环境的各项参数,包括水流、水质、流向等关键指标,说明该技术能够实时监测地下水动态变化,为地下水资源管理和保护提供科学依据,还具有操作简便、测量精度高、成本低廉等优点,适合在广泛区域进行应用和推广。由此可知,井地结合测井技术在地下水环境数据监测中具有显著的应用价值。

    Abstract:

    In this paper, application of well ground combined logging technology in monitoring groundwater environmental data has been studied, so as to achieve effective protection and sustainable utilization of groundwater resources. Through measuring representative groundwater monitoring wells, combining with geological background data and data analysis, groundwater environment has been comprehensively and systematically monitored. After field application, well and ground combined logging technology can accurately obtain various parameters of groundwater environment, such as water flow, water quality and flow direction. It is indicaed that the technology can monitor dynamic changes of groundwater in real time, provide scientific basis for groundwater resource management and protection. It has the advantages of simple operation, high measurement accuracy and low cost. It is suitable for promotion and application in a wide range of areas. It can be seen that well ground combined logging technology has significant application value in monitoring groundwater environmental data.
